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(184, 63%, 12%) | color: hsl(184, 63%, 12%) | |
| HEX | #0B2F32 | color: #0B2F32 | |
| RGB | rgb(11, 47, 50) | color: rgb(11, 47, 50)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(78%, 6%, 0%, 80%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(185, 78%, 20%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(185 4% 80%) | color: hwb(185 4% 80%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.2815 0.0403 203) | color: oklch(0.2815 0.0403 203) | |
| Lab | lab(17.15 -11.37 -5.68) | color: lab(17.15 -11.37 -5.68) | |
| LCH | lch(17.15 12.71 206.54) | color: lch(17.15 12.71 206.54) |

What colors go well with #0B2F32?
The complementary color is HSL(4, 63%, 12%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 184°, 304°, and 64°. For analogous combinations, try hues 154° and 214°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
